叠层方式形成彩色滤光片隔垫物的研究

Forming photo spacer by layer stacking on TFT-LCD CF substrate

Abstract

The key issue of forming photo spacer by layer stacking on TFT-LCD CF substrate,such as height control,main-sub difference tuning and the variation of main-sub different after OC process is investigated.Corresponding solution has been proposed.A shape-following OC material is used to control PS height by tuning OC thickness,which indicates that the thickness of BM,Red,Green,Blue layer won't has to be changed to achieve certain stacking height.The main-sub difference can be acquired by changing pattern size of each Stacking layers.The tuning range of main-sub difference is 0.4~1.2 μm,which already reaches the level of half tone mask technology,but at much lower cost.It is confirmed that the main-sub difference formed by BM/R/G/B layer stacking can be maintained after OC process.A prototype of 4 mask Color filter is fabricated,based on stacking photo spacer technology.
